Funding Would Add D.C. Train Service to 2 Va. Cities

Lynchburg, Richmond would get connections

LYNCHBURG, Va.  -- The Virginia Department of Rail and Public Transportation is recommending $17 million to add passenger train service between Washington, D.C. and two Virginia cities.

The money would provide additional trains between the nation's capital and Lynchburg and Richmond.

If the Commonwealth Transportation Board approves the recommendation in January, agency spokeswoman Jennifer Pickett said a second daily train could depart Lynchburg by the fall of 2009.

Commuters have been asking for more trains for more than a decade.
